About The Position

Lockheed Martin: An Award-Winning Place to Work WHO YOU ARE Lockheed Martin’s Autonomy, Intelligence & Maritime Solutions (AIMS) market segment is looking for a disciplined contract professional to own the full contract life‑cycle for classified projects. This position sits in Palm Beach, FL.

Requirements

  • B.A./B.S. in Business, Finance, Law, or related field; advanced degree or certifications (e.g., CPCM, CFCM) preferred.
  • Proven ability to negotiate, interpret, and enforce complex contracts across the DoD acquisition spectrum.
  • Strong stakeholder‑management skills and the ability to influence without authority.
  • Ability to obtain Top Secret clearance (TS/SCI).

Nice To Haves

  • 5+ years of contract management experience, preferably on classified defense programs.
  • Hands‑on experience leading negotiations and internal / external audits, ensuring delegation‑of‑authority sign‑offs, and documenting compliance evidence.
  • Proficiency in collecting, analyzing, and presenting contract performance data; familiarity with corporate reporting tools and metrics dashboards.
  • Analytical mindset with a task‑completion focus
  • Excellent written / oral communication with ability to distill complex clauses into plain English
  • Active Top Secret clearance (TS/SCI).

Responsibilities

  • Lead contract capture, proposal development, award negotiations, and ongoing administration for supplies and services.
  • Serve as the authorized Company representative to the Customer’s buying team; build and sustain effective relationships that drive business objectives.
  • Coordinate with Program Management, Finance, Legal, Subcontracts, Business Development, Engineering, HR, Accounting, and Compliance to resolve contractual issues and fulfill obligations.
  • Ensure all actions comply with applicable laws, regulations, FAR/DFARS clauses, Delegation of Authority, and internal approval requirements.
  • Direct internal and external audits, verify compliance, and implement corrective actions as needed.
  • Produce and maintain contractual data, metrics, and reports for corporate and Business Area stakeholders.
  • Develop and deliver contract‑management training to internal teams as required.
